Misting double glazing repairs Glazed Repair

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pgDouble glass that is misted could cause your doors and windows to operate less effectively. This is usually due to an opening in the seal that allows moisture to get into the insulation section of the window unit.

It is essential to discover a solution as quickly as you can when this issue occurs. In the absence of a solution, it can increase the cost of energy and a further degradation of the windows.

Seals

As time passes, the seals which keep the inert gases between the two panes of glass can be less effective. If this isn't repaired the window can fog up with water vapour accumulating between the glass panes. If left unchecked, this could result in a decrease in the efficiency of your window. This could result in more energy costs and humidity getting into your home. It is crucial if you suspect that your double glazing is no longer sealing.

Rather than replacing the whole window, you can ask your double glazing misting repair service to drill into the window repairs near me that is affected and make use of a kit that has drying pellets (similar to silica gel that is found in new shoe boxes) to clear the condensation out between the panes. This could solve the issue and is a cheaper alternative to replacing the sealed unit. It's important to keep in mind that this isn't a permanent fix and the condensation may return within some weeks, unless you take steps to prevent it.

The moisture that enters your home through windows can cause damp and even mold which is not just unsightly but can damage your property and affect health. It can also cause discomfort for people suffering from respiratory issues and asthma. If damp isn't taken care of, it may lead to rotting ceilings and walls. These may require to be replaced.

A double-glazed window that isn't sealed will not let moisture in your home, but it could let heat escape, resulting in an increase in energy costs. Seals that fail can also let warm air escape while cold air can infiltrate, reducing the insulation of your home.

You can try DIY methods to fix the misted windows, but the best solution is to replace the sealed units. This is less costly than replacing the entire window and still provides you with a an energy-efficient, high-performance window. Additionally you can upgrade your window to low-e glass to improve the performance of your double glazing.

Spacer Bars

Double-glazed windows are a great way to keep your home dry and warm. However should they begin to appear cloudy, you must take action. Double glazed windows that have condensation between the glass and the glass is a sign of a damaged seal which means that the insulating properties are no longer effective and cold draughts could be infiltrating, as well as moisture from outside that can damage your windows frames and cill.

This could result from damage incurred during installation, delivery or wear and tear from age. It is essential to have your double-glazed sealed units checked regularly. Mr Misty will seal the sealed unit to improve its insulation properties and prevent issues like water and draught ingress.

This can be caused by the spacer bar becoming dislodged. This can happen due to a variety of reasons.

Check for small black marks on the frame and cill to determine if your spacer bar has become loose. These are signs of a spacer bar that is loose and can be fixed with a flat head screwdriver to insert the corner keys that secure the end of the spacer bar. they are located at the outer edge of the frame and are very easy to remove.

It is a good practice to clean the edges of the glass where the bead had been stuck. This will prevent the bead from sticking to the glass when reassembling the window. It is also necessary to carefully clean the face of the second glass pane that will sit on the top of the spacer bar making sure there aren't any marks or smears from the sealant used during the initial installation.

Ventilation

There are several ways in which misted double glazing can be fixed according to the severity of the issue and the amount you're prepared to spend. Certain companies will make holes in the panes to allow for ventilation, which helps to remove moisture. Certain companies employ anti-fog or a combination to prevent condensation. In certain instances replacing the window unit completely could be the best choice since it can help eliminate the issue completely.

The mist that is seen in double-glazed windows is caused by air getting trapped between the glass panes which is typically filled with argon gas for extra thermal efficiency. This gas creates a barrier that keeps cold air out and warm air in. If the seals are damaged the gas argon could escape, causing the windows to become misty.

It is most noticeable in the morning when condensation from dew forms on the cold glass. This is a common occurrence, and repaired it's nothing to be concerned about. However, a double-glazed window may lose some of its insulation properties.

Over time, the seals around a double-glazed window can deteriorate making the glass become cloudy. This can be a nuisance as it may impede your view and make your home appear untidy.

Often, the culprit is an internal seal that has been damaged or a crack or break in one of the panes of glass. It could be caused by environmental factors, aging or damage sustained during installation. The seal or gasket, which holds the two glass panes in place, can also be broken by cracks that are hairline or fractures. This can cause the insulated glass to be depressurized and allow moisture to accumulate between the panes.

As soon as you begin to notice that the seals are beginning to fail, it's imperative that you get the double-glazed windows repaired. This can affect your home's energy efficiency, and can cause black mould to develop. A professional should be sought out to determine the cause of your windows becoming misty and find the best solution for you.
